LOVE SHOCK Carla Plans Romantic Proposal to Lisa — But Coronation Street Surprise Backfires

Coronation Street (29 Aug 2025) delivered a tender yet turbulent twist as Carla’s heartfelt plan to propose to Lisa took an unexpected turn — proving even the most romantic gestures can unravel in Weatherfield.

Carla’s Grand Idea

For weeks, Carla had been quietly plotting a surprise. Determined to show Lisa just how much she meant to her, Carla arranged a romantic setting filled with all the small details that spoke to their bond — a private dinner, a carefully chosen ring, and even a speech she had rehearsed over and over in her head.

Her plan was simple but powerful: to take Lisa’s breath away with a proposal she would never forget. Friends noticed Carla’s nervous excitement, her constant checking of her phone and rehearsing lines under her breath. For Carla, this was more than romance — it was a declaration of security and a leap into the future.

The Moment Arrives

As the evening unfolded, Carla’s nerves were clear. Her voice trembled as she began her speech, reminding Lisa of their journey together and how love had pulled them through every storm. “You’ve made me stronger, Lisa,” Carla whispered, before reaching for the ring.

But the carefully constructed surprise faltered. Lisa, overwhelmed by the intensity of the moment, hesitated. The silence hung heavy. Instead of the swift, joyful acceptance Carla imagined, doubts crept into the air.

A Backfiring Surprise

The proposal wasn’t rejected outright, but the hesitation was enough to sting. Lisa admitted she hadn’t expected something so sudden. She needed time, space to breathe before making such a life-changing commitment.

For Carla, the pause cut deep. What was meant to be a symbol of stability became another source of uncertainty. The ring box on the table became a reminder that love — even the strongest — can falter when timing goes awry.

Hope in the Shadows

Despite the stumble, the emotion between them was undeniable. Carla’s vulnerability laid bare just how deeply she cares, while Lisa’s reluctance wasn’t about lack of love but about being caught unprepared. The episode closed with them holding hands, both visibly shaken yet bound by affection.

A Future Still Possible

Coronation Street painted the moment with tenderness rather than tragedy. The proposal may not have gone to plan, but the bond between Carla and Lisa remains. Sometimes love stories don’t follow a perfect script — and that very imperfection may lead them to something even stronger.
